10. Areas of Military Specialization

10.1 General Information

Each year, the Canadian Forces selects, sponsors and sends to graduate study a number of officers to obtain education and qualification in subject areas of special importance and need to the military. These areas of speciality are denoted as the Occupational Speciality Specification (OSS) and are denoted within the military administration by a four letter alphanumeric code.

Some of the descriptors used by the military for the OSS codes link directly to a degree programme such as the ADTU, AEOV, AEOW, AEOX, AEPB, AESV that are respectively named Electrical, Mechanical, Civil, Nuclear, and Chemical Engineering, and Business Administration. Other codes may not link in an obvious way to a degree programme such as ADOM Aerospace Systems, ADSB Telecommunications Management and AEPC Guided Weapons Systems, all of which require study in Electrical Engineering; AEOR Underwater Acoustics and AIEI Ocean Acoustics lie in Physics; and AESX Military Strategic Studies lies in War Studies.

Some OSS codes describe a speciality that may be best realized via an interdisciplinary programme tailored to meet the needs of the military and the sponsor. These include AENM Operations Research, AEPM Management Information Systems, AERK Systems Engineering, all of which would involve the Departments of Electrical & Computer Engineering, Mathematics & Computer Science, and Business Administration.

Graduate degrees currently offered at RMC under Department of National Defence sponsorship are listed by degree title in the left hand column below. For convenience, in the right hand column where available are shown the corresponding OSS (Occupational Speciality Specification) designators for those programmes of graduate study sponsored under the Canadian Forces Postgraduate General Training Program which are normally available at RMC.
